AI Summary

  • Establishes the Florida Museum of Black History Board of Directors to oversee the commission, construction, operation, and administration of the museum in St. Johns County

  • Board consists of 13 members: 3 appointed by the Governor (including the chair), 3 by the Senate President, 3 by the House Speaker, plus 2 ex officio Senators and 2 ex officio Representatives

  • All appointments must be made by July 31, 2026; non-legislative appointees are prohibited from holding state or local elective office while serving on the board

  • Board must work jointly with the Foundation for the Museum of Black History, Inc., a nonprofit organization supporting museum creation

  • St. Johns County Board of County Commissioners must provide administrative support and staffing until project planning, design, and engineering are completed; effective date July 1, 2026
